DAVIS, Kenneth C.
DAVIS, Kenneth C. American. Genres: Cultural/Ethnic topics, History, Social commentary. Career: Writer. Publications: Two-Bit Culture: The Paperbacking of America, 1984. DON'T KNOW MUCH ABOUT…: History, 1990; Geography, 1992; the Civil War, 1996; the Bible, 1998; the Solar System, 2001; the Universe, 2001; Space, 2001; the Fifty States, 2001; the Pilgrims, 2001; the Planet Earth (for Kids!), 2001; the Presidents, 2002; the Kings and Queens of England, 2002; the Pioneers, 2002; the Dinosaurs, 2003.
